    I read that the Patterdale people prefer people not to mix anymore APBT into the breed. Because the Bull Terrier blood was added for bravery, but made a not so "smart" hunter. It would grab on and just hold instead of get a new hold.

    There has been pitter-pats for a long time now. That's why ADBA changed the rules on weight pull for small dogs too, no dog under 30 lbs. I would never mix, wouldn't think of it, but they are out there.

    <tt><tt>How many Terriers is breed today who is only from proven workers? We here at Hurricane think that the Patterdale is the best earth dog in the World. Its a rare breed of dog but only performance have set this line of dogs. Our strain of Patterdales is based on the Nuttall strain and we have get all our Nuttall breed dogs directly from Nuttalls yard. We even have one of His broodbiches here. We keep both smooth and broken coated dogs. Not any of our dogs carry one drip of Show ring blood and we never have/will show any of our dogs. We think they look good but we bred em only for confrontation. 99% of the work we do is badger/fox. And we never breed a cold or cur male/bitch. All stock we use in breeding have proof themself in the earth NOT once but time after time that they are the real deal. If you are serious about earth-hunting get in contact with us.</tt></tt>
